GitHub Actions
Automate your workflow from idea to production
★ 4.6
Automate, customize, and execute software development workflows in your GitHub repository. The most popular CI/CD platform.
cloud
Deployment
usage
Pricing
Yes
Self-Hostable
Features
- ✓ YAML workflows
- ✓ Matrix builds
- ✓ Reusable workflows
- ✓ Self-hosted runners
- ✓ Marketplace actions
- ✓ Secrets management
- ✓ Environments
- ✓ Artifact storage
Pros
- + Deep GitHub integration
- + Huge marketplace
- + Great free tier for public repos
- + Easy to start
- + Matrix builds
Cons
- − YAML complexity
- − Debugging is hard
- − Minutes can run out
- − Runner limitations